At the heart of every service and support operation is a set of core operational metrics used to measure the quality of service delivered to customers, yet technology service and support executives have historically been hampered by a lack of industry standard metrics with which to benchmark their performance. Few operational benchmark databases exist, and most of those are conglomerations of data from IT help desks and call centers, missing any true comparisons for ‘best in class’ technology support.
SSPA Research fills this void with a wealth of industry data and analytical frameworks that provide the foundation for a rich and rewarding member experience. Our SSPA Benchmarking database contains over 200 metrics, across department financials, services marketing, support operations, field service operations and customer satisfaction, with robust controls that allow you to granularly compare your performance against industry peers.
